Releases: etianl/Trouser-Streak
Trouser-Streak v0.9.2
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
InstaMineNuker and InstaSafetyBox updates
- Remove the duplicated calling of InstaMineNuker from Trouser.java in the source.
- Added a bit of code to prevent duplicate block positions being added to the array for placing blocks with InstaSafetyBox
- Removed the max of 5 on "Blocks per Tick" in InstaSafetyBox, the slider now goes up to 10 as originally intended and there is no cap on the integer that you type in.
- Made centering the player and auto crouching on surfaces like slabs optional in InstaSafetyBox.
- Added a Box shape mode for placing blocks with InstaSafetyBox, and for breaking blocks with InstaMineNuker. The default option was and still is a spherical shape.
- Removed the max cap on the reach options in InstaSafetyBox and InstaMineNuker. I also made a seperate range option for Box and Sphere mode because the max range on box mode is smaller than sphere mode.
- Reduced the slider max on range for sphere mode from 6 to 5 because 6 doesn't work right.
- Made the available block positions to break with InstaMineNuker one block taller.
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.9.1
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
-
Added the InstaSafetyBox module which places a box around you for safety using the hardest blocks available in your hotbar. Also with adjustable range for thic box.
-
Added a "Blocks to not use" option to AutoLavaCaster and to TrouserBuild
-
Cleaned up the cascadingpileof() function in AutoMountain, AutoLavaCaster, and TrouserBuild.
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.9.0
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
-
Added the InstaMineNuker module, which sends packets to instantly mine the blocks around you until they are gone. There is an option in it to make it only target instamineable blocks such as crops, grass, slimeblocks, and more. (Credits to etianl and to Meteor Client, as well as Meteor Rejects for some borrowed code)
note InstaMineNuker is not compatible with AutoTool for now -
Added a line to the .world command which tells you if the chunk you are in is new or old generation (pre or post 1.17 generation). Do this at spawn to see if old world.
NewerNewChunks fixes
- Fixed a bug with the pre-1.17 old chunk detection that caused all the chunks in the nether, end, and flat worlds to be marked as old.
- Stopped block checks for the pre-1.17 old chunk detector if a block is found that it is looking for per chunk (improve performance maybe?).
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.8.9
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
-
Added a "Pre 1.17 OldChunk Detector" to NewerNewChunks which marks chunks as old if they in the overworld and do not have any copper ores above a Y level of 0. Useful for tracing servers that have been updated from an old version to the new build limits. (maybe 2b2t?)
-
Fixed HandOfGod not being able to /fill blocks close to the build limits. Now the Y values in the fill commands are constrained to build limit. The only fill commands I couldn't apply this to was the ones for doing the /fill around all players on the server.
-
Reduced command length before throwing an error from 257 back to 256 in AutoScoreboard, AutoCommand, and other modules because on some servers the slash is actually included in the character count.
-
Added a couple extra "Manual" modes to AutoCommand so you can have a few different command profiles.
-
Added a "Blocks to not use" block list option to AutoMountain.
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.8.8
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
- Added the GarbageCleanerCommand which is accessable by typing ".cleanram". It cleans the RAM of useless junk and may be very handy for improving performance after chunk tracing for a while and can be used to clear other lag. (credits to ogmur for writing this)
- Changed the default "Don't Burn Range" in LavaAura to 3 from 2.25 because it's safer.
- Added a tickdelay option to LavaAura to help you conserve flints when trying the "Burn Everything" option.
- Made LavaAura only target lava source blocks for pickup because it was rotating to and trying to snatch up flowing lava with the bucket.
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.8.7
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
LavaAura Updates
- Made LavaAura not target the entities you have listed when using the "Lava/Burn Everything" option.
- Added options for "Lava/Burn Everything" that can filter out blocks below your Y level, and another to target only flammable blocks.
- Added a blocklist setting for "Lava/Burn Everything" that makes it skip burning the blocks in the list.
- Allowed the placeFire (FIRE mode) function in LavaAura to place fire against any side of the blocks.
- Added an option to allow you to define how big of an area around the player to not burn.
TPFly Updates
- Added an acceleration option to TPFly to allow you to move a little bit at a time when flying with it.
- Updated the PointAndFly option mode in TPFly and renamed it to "Normal" mode as well as made Normal mode default.
- The Normal flight mode in TPfly will teleport you along the Y level you are at as you push the forward button in the direction you are facing. All the other directions were fixed in a similar way and TPFly actually feels like a normal flight module now.
- Fixed the antikick not working in TPFly.
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.8.6
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
- Added a disable on disconnect option to HandOfGod that's false by default.
- Added a BlockList option to SuperInstamine that allows you to select which blocks to not target for instamining.
AutoDisplays Updates
- Added an option that will toggle AutoDisplays off when there is no one else online.
- Fixed AutoDisplays not killing entities onDeactivate when kill entities is enabled.
- Changed the kill command to allow it to work on more different servers.
Airstrike+ Updates
- Added a "Rainbow Name Colors" option which randomizes the color used for custom name colors for entities.
- Added an "Airstrike Everyone" option which spawns the entities around every player on the server. Requires OP mode.
- The "Airstrike Everyone" option uses commands, so I made it use a seperate set of nbt tags from the main ones to conserve on characters because of the character limit on commands.
- Changed the slider max on the Health and Absorption Points tags to 10,000 (it can probably still go higher than this).
- Added a "Concurrent Spawns" option which controls how many entities are spawned per tick.
- Added a block option so you can specify what block falling_block entities are spawned as.
- Added a Random Prefix for Name option which adds a bit of text to the beginnings of each entity's name to bypass the Boss Stacker module. (credits to ogmur for figuring that out)
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.8.5
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
- Fixed LavaAura accidentally interacting with interactable blocks when using the FIRE mode. To place fire on those blocks you must hold the sneak key.
- Fixed a bug with AirStrike+ where it would force the character to interact with a block that they are standing on over and over again.
- Fixed the error messages that say "command too long" in AutoCommand, AutoScoreboard, AutoTitles, HandOfGod, and OPServerKillModule modules. It was being triggered by a string of 256 characters in length where it should actually be 257 because minecraft apparently excludes the / in the character count for commands.
- Included how many characters you need to delete into the error messages for the modules above as well as AutoDisplay
- Added a disable on disconnect option to AutoDisplay and Voider that's false by default.
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.8.4
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
- AutoScoreboard fix, I forgot a return statement which was causing the module to spam ridiculously to no end.
- Implemented more precise range calculations for LavaAura when using the lava/burn everything option, and for extinquishing fire and picking up lava.
- Adjusted lava pickup delay default in LavaAura to 2 instead of 1 because it feels a little better.
See the releases page for previous changelogs if you missed the last couple updates. :)
Trouser-Streak v0.8.3
Release for 1.20.4, and 1.20.2! Use the correct jar for your version. Source for 1.20.2 is in the zip file here, and in the 1.20.2 branch.
note: this version has a bugged out AutoScoreboard module which I will be fixing very shortly
- AutoDisplay module added which automatically spams block displays around all player's heads to blind them or text displays around them for trolling or advertising. Requires operator access.
- Added a "FIRE" mode to LavaAura which can make use of either Flint and Steel or Fire Charges to burn entities. There is a new option added in relation to that for automatically extinguishing the fire.
- Added a new option to LavaAura to not burn entities if they are already burning. (Mainly for the FIRE option in LavaAura to conserve flints)
- Removed the .onlyAttackable() filter from the entity list setting in AutoLava so you can target any entity with it such as items.
- Made the .crash command by default crash all players but you if no player is specified.
- Added error messages that say Command too long and may toggle the module off or skip over the command to save you from getting kicked from server for AutoCommand, AutoScoreboard, AutoTitles, HandOfGod, and OPServerKillModule modules.
See the releases page for previous changelogs if you missed the last couple updates. :)